**Action item (pool tuning):** So, the Gristmill outage was basically us letting the connection pool grow until the database fell over. We've since capped pool size per service and added an idle reaper, which future maintainers should not remove without reading the incident doc first. If you're tempted to raise the cap during a traffic spike, don't — scale replicas instead. The pool genuinely behaves once bounded. For posterity, the settings we landed on are recorded below.

limits module of fajog-tawig:
RATE_LIMITS = {
    "druwyn": 2,
    "quenael": 10,
    "wenix": 2,
    "druael": 2,
}

- [ ] **Step 7: Breaker override escrow.** After sealing the signing keys for the Tallgrove upstream API circuit breaker, confirm the support team can force the breaker open during a full outage. The override bundle lives in the sealed escrow drawer and is useless without its unlock phrase. Two ceremony witnesses must initial this step before proceeding. The escrow bundle is decrypted with the recovery passphrase that follows.

vault phrase of kahip-kahop = holath-quenmir

## 3.2.0 — Changed defaults

Heads up for the release notes: FanoutForge's backpressure defaults changed in this version. We got tired of the notification fan-out tipping over whenever a big broadcast landed, so the queue now sheds load earlier and retries back off more aggressively. Most tenants won't notice anything except fewer 3 a.m. pages. Anyone who tuned the old defaults by hand should re-check their overrides before upgrading, since the semantics of two knobs shifted slightly. The new default configuration values are as follows.

service settings:
PRAIX_LOG_LEVEL=error
PRAIX_METRICS_HOST=metrics.praix.qorvelcorp.corp
PRAIX_POOL_SIZE=16

**CI note: Duskqueue backfill scheduler flaking on nightly runs**

Duskqueue's nightly backfill job fails intermittently at the partition-claim step. Root cause: lease table contention when two runners start within the same second. Workaround until the fix lands: retry the stage once, max. Do not bump concurrency — it makes contention worse. If it fails twice, page the data platform rotation. Reference the trace token below when escalating.

pipeline stamp: htk9_ce63042d9